Cockatoo Care Guide: How to Keep Your Bird Happy and Healthy

Cockatoos are loving, intelligent, and social parrots that thrive when given the right care. Proper nutrition, enrichment, hygiene, and bonding are all essential to keeping your feathered friend healthy and content. Here’s everything you need to know about cockatoo pet care.


1. Nutrition and Diet for Cockatoos

A balanced diet is the foundation of your cockatoo’s health.

  • Pellets: Should make up about 60–70% of the diet.
  • Fresh Fruits & Vegetables: Add variety and essential vitamins (avoid avocado, chocolate, and caffeine).
  • Seeds & Nuts: Offer as occasional treats, not the main diet.
  • Fresh Water: Always provide clean, filtered water.

2. Housing and Environment

Cockatoos need space to stretch, climb, and explore.

  • Cage Size: Choose the largest cage possible with strong bars.
  • Perches: Provide natural wood perches to help with foot health.
  • Safe Space: Keep cages away from drafts, fumes, and direct sunlight.

3. Hygiene and Grooming

Good hygiene keeps your cockatoo comfortable and healthy.

  • Bathing: Offer regular showers or misting to keep feathers clean.
  • Beak & Nails: Monitor and trim if needed (an avian vet can help).
  • Cage Cleaning: Remove droppings daily and deep-clean weekly.

4. Socialization and Mental Stimulation

Cockatoos are highly social and can become bored easily.

  • Interaction: Spend at least 2–3 hours daily bonding with your bird.
  • Toys: Provide chew toys, foraging puzzles, and safe wood blocks.
  • Training: Teach simple tricks to keep their minds active.

5. Health and Veterinary Care

Regular vet visits help prevent hidden illnesses.

  • Annual Checkups: An avian vet should examine your cockatoo at least once a year.
  • Observation: Watch for changes in eating, droppings, or behavior.
  • Emergency Signs: Lethargy, labored breathing, or sudden feather plucking require immediate vet attention.
